Surface Mining Applications

Surface mining represents an important application area because large-scale open-pit operations require extensive rock fragmentation. Controlled blasting can help prepare material for excavation and transportation.

Large mining operations increasingly use computerized blast-design systems, electronic initiation technologies, and real-time monitoring to improve precision. These technologies can help companies optimize fragmentation and reduce unwanted effects on surrounding areas.

Underground Mining

Underground mining creates different technical requirements because operations take place in confined environments. Controlled blasting must account for geological conditions, ventilation, tunnel dimensions, and worker safety.

As accessible surface deposits become more limited in some regions, underground mining may gain greater importance. This can increase demand for specialized blasting systems and advanced monitoring technologies.

Technology and Digitalization

Digital technologies are changing blasting practices. Modern systems can incorporate geological models, automated design tools, electronic initiation, drones, sensors, and data analytics.

These technologies enable mining companies to analyze blast outcomes and optimize future operations. Improved fragmentation can potentially reduce downstream crushing and grinding requirements, creating operational and energy-efficiency benefits.

Remote monitoring and automation can also reduce personnel exposure to hazardous areas and improve operational control.

Sustainability and Safety

Environmental and safety considerations are increasingly important. Mining companies are seeking blasting technologies that improve fragmentation while reducing vibration, noise, flyrock, dust, and other environmental impacts.

Electronic initiation systems and advanced blast modeling can improve precision and control. Responsible handling, storage, transportation, and use of explosive materials remain essential throughout the mining value chain.
